MP Launches Fully Online, Transparent Recruitment for Anganwadi Workers, CM Mohan Yadav Calls Appointment Letters a ‘Pledge’ to Women
Published On
By Aryan Age Bureau
Madhya Pradesh Chief Minister Mohan Yadav announces the state’s first fully online and transparent recruitment process for Anganwadi workers, highlighting the initiative as a pledge to empower qualified women and strengthen community welfare services. The move marks a significant reform in administrative transparency.
